来更新后续了,
02-25 送到高雄快修中心,
02-27 台北威健维修部说测试正常,仍可送原厂测试,但会附上威健测试截图,
03-09 通知取件,
前文提到 02-27 当日请维修工程师寄给我测试相关环境与步骤,
但到高雄快修中心通知可取件为止,
威健台北维修部都没有将测试相关环境与步骤寄信给我...
直到03-09当天在高雄快修中心打电话去才告知:
除了 64G内存之外还要 Ubuntu 18.04,
当然这部分可能也是威健自行认定的,因为威健跟 AMD 都没有这部分的公开资讯,
只能从这次附回来的测试报告中自行推理,
加上另外再看了很多国外的讨论,
得出以下结论:
1. 最好使用以下这只程式测试
https://github.com/Oxalin/ryzen-test/archive/master.zip
若使用 https://github.com/suaefar/ryzen-test/archive/master.zip
需搭配原装的 Ubuntu 17.04 才能有正确的测试结果,
不可进行任何套件或软件升级,
这部分在 https://github.com/suaefar/ryzen-test 有提到:
To get as close as possible to the conditions that
I had when testing my CPUs,
you should run the script on a Ubuntu 17.04. live system,
e.g., from a USB drive WITHOUT ANY UPDATES.
(这大概只会发生在 Live USB 上,一般正常使用多年多少都会升级部分软件)
否则升级之后在某些情形下可能会有 False positive 假阳性
gcc7.1 碰上 glib 2.26
https://gcc.gnu.org/bugzilla/show_bug.cgi?id=81712
在 https://github.com/OXalin/ryzen-test 也可以看到相关说明
This fork uses GCC 7.2.0 instead of the original 7.1.0 because
the latter was causing problem (read "failing")
against glib 2.26 and newer.
2. 推测可能需出现 segfault 或 Segmentation fault 字眼才算,
仅出现 build failed 并不代表一定是 CPU 有问题,
因为威健自己的测试报告也是有 build failed,而威健还说测试正常,
在下先前那次测试 20分钟左右跑出 build failed 就结束测试,
所以截图结果也只有 Build failed,至于为什么那次威健还让我换CPU呢?
不知道是威健维修部工程师也不懂?还是有帮我测试出 segfault?
还是看到1708周次的CPU就未测先送原厂?
当时威健仅说会帮我送回原厂测试,
可能是原厂后来测久一点有跑出 segfault?不然原厂也不会认赔换,
个人用同样的设备跟步骤跑出差不多时间的同样结果,
第一次威健直接给换,
第二次威健就改成要系统有 64G 才承认?
但宣称正常的测试报告里面自己没有附 64G 证明截图?!
这中间的疑点我猜威健要让使用者放弃或猜测吧...
3. 依据测试报告截图 (日期是02/27,应该是威健自行测试的,标题为
Test result screen shot)
https://i.imgur.com/Xhk9a6s.jpg
https://i.imgur.com/rKfjhxK.jpg
3-1. 使用 Ubuntu 18.04
3-2. R7 1700 3000MHz 无超频
3-3. 从截图里的 gcc-7.1看来推测使用 suaefar 版本的测试程式
3-4. 框了一个 Out of memory 不知何意,再来是多行 build failed 出现在13xx秒,
根据 suaefar 版本的说明,在 16GB 内存执行kill-ryzen.sh时需使用 4 4
参数才不会出现 Out of memory
如果只是附上使用不到64 GB 会出问题的截图给我的话,
实在不能说是测试正常
3-5. 另一页报告(可能是 AMD 附的) 则写出执行 Ryzen Test Master long run
with 12 hours pass.
也就是执行12小时都没有问题,
我在 64GB 环境与 OXalin 版本的测试程式跑了一整夜,的确没有出现 segfault。
目前威健并没有提供测试 SOP,
而威健工程师似乎疲于奔命,专业与检查流程上似乎还有待加强,
我把使用设备的清单列在随 CPU 寄去的说明文件(两次都有寄)上,
竟然还在电话里问我使用多少内存...
虽然这个包是 AMD 出的,但代理商没有一致且公开的处理 SOP,该小小检讨!
还附上不是正常测试结果的截图,
只能说威健工程师大概太操了,
累到头都昏了吧...